Case for Hackaday 2018 Conference Badge I designed myself. There is another 3d-printed case here https://hackaday.io/project/162134-hackaday-superconference-2018-badge-enclosure, but I didn't like it as it is heavy, massive and hard to print.

My version doesn't require any supports to be generated, require 2.5 hours to print the bottom part and 4 hours to print the top cover (on my settings).

There are two versions of top cover - with and without logo. If you want to print version with logo, you need to slice Logo*.stl files in separate print (make sure they have the same offset as cover), print them, then replace plastic and print the rest of the case.
